How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    You will like

    Engineering software for aerospace innovator relocating to Swindon Wiltshire offering you the opportunity to work with a dynamic and innovative private company, committed to pushing the boundaries in UAV and drone technology. Based in the heart of Wiltshire, this organisation values its engineering talent and provides a nurturing environment where your expertise can make a tangible impact. Enjoy the stability of a well-established team combined with the excitement of working on cutting-edge projects within a friendly, professional setting.

    You will like

    The Software Engineer (C++, Python, and MATLAB) role itself where you will design, develop, and deliver robust software solutions that underpin crucial technical functions for advanced drones. You’ll work within a multidisciplinary engineering team, influencing the entire development lifecycle — from analysing requirements and architecture design to implementation, testing, and deployment. Your contributions will directly support the organisation’s strategic goals, while providing opportunities to stay at the forefront of emerging UAV technologies.

    You will have

    To be successful as Software Engineer here you will have proven experience as a Software Engineer or Development Engineer, ideally within the UAV, drone, or embedded systems sector. Plus a healthy mix of the following:

    Strong proficiency in C++, Python, and MATLAB, particularly in flight controller coding (Ardupilot, PX4).

    Good understanding of flight dynamics, autopilot systems, and PID controller tuning.

    Experience with Real-Time Operating Systems (RTOS) and UNIX-based OS environments.

    Familiarity with DroneCAN communication protocol and source code management using Git.

    Background in designing analogue and digital electronics, including signal conditioning and filter design.

    Experience with ARM architecture, embedded debugging tools, and hardware schematics analysis.

    Knowledge of modern software practices, standards, and communication protocols such as SPI, I2C, TCP/IP, etc.

    A relevant University Degree (Engineering or related) or HND with practical experience.

    Self-motivated with the ability to work independently on all technical aspects, plus a collaborative team spirit.

    An understanding of CE requirements for electronic products and project management frameworks.

    (Desirable) Experience with rapid prototyping, cloud platforms, containerisation, or DevOps practices.

    SC cleared status or eligible to obtain SC clearance

    You will get

    As a Software Engineer here, you will enjoy a competitive salary dependent on experience (£40,000 - £50,000) plus a comprehensive benefits package, including:

    Flexible working hours with core hours between 09:00 – 15:00

    25 days annual leave plus Bank Holidays

    Private medical insurance and life assurance (4x salary)

    High street discounts and other wellbeing benefits

    Option for hybrid working for added flexibility

    EV salary sacrifice scheme and up to 8% matched pension contributions

    Supportive environment promoting development and innovation in a friendly team
